What is the Medication Therapy Management Letter?

The Medication Therapy Management (MTM) Letter serves as a crucial healthcare document designed to enhance patient medication management. This letter is integral in ensuring patients effectively track their medications and communicate vital information with healthcare providers. The MTM letter plays a pivotal role in improving health outcomes by fostering better medication adherence and encouraging collaboration among healthcare professionals.

Key Features of the Medication Therapy Management Letter

Key components of the MTM letter include various fillable fields that capture essential patient information. For instance, fields such as Beneficiary Name, Street Address, and sections for the action plan are included to guide the documentation process. Notably, the pharmacist's signature is crucial as it validates the document and confirms the professional review of the patient's medication regimen.
  • Beneficiary Name and Street Address fields
  • Action plan sections to outline patient tasks
  • Pharmacist's signature for validation
